On average across the year,
no, Rhode Island, United States is not hotter than
Albany Park, Illinois
.
Rhode Island, United States has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F and Albany Park, Illinois has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F.
Rhode Island,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F, which is not hotter than Albany Park, Illinois's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F).
On average across the year, yes, Rhode Island, United States is colder than Albany Park, Illinois . Rhode Island, United States has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F and Albany Park, Illinois has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.
On average across the year,
yes, Rhode Island, United States has more rain than
Albany Park, Illinois. Rhode Island, United States has an average annual rainfall of 1354mm and Albany Park, Illinois has an average annual rainfall of 1012mm.
Rhode Island, United States's wettest month is December, with an average monthly rainfall of 138mm, which is wetter than Albany Park, Illinois's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 133mm).
